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and a 50 percent discount on exams.
Get startedEarn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Estoy tratando de crear un informe para nuestro equipo de RRHH para automatizar nuestro sistema de nómina, pero estoy teniendo problemas con los períodos de pago de agrupación de columnas.
Esto es lo que la tabla se ve actualmente:
MemberID | Hours_Logged | Timesheet_Period |
781 | 30 | 2020-03-01 a 2020-03-07 |
781 | 10 | 2020-03-08 a 2020-03-15 |
781 | 26 | 2020-03-01 a 2020-03-07 |
781 | 14 | 2020-03-08 a 2020-03-15 |
Este es el resultado que estoy buscando:
MemberID | Hours_Logged | Timesheet_Period | WeekTotal |
781 | 30 | 2020-03-01 a 2020-03-07 | 40 |
781 | 26 | 2020-03-08 a 2020-03-15 | 36 |
781 | 10 | 2020-03-01 a 2020-03-07 | 40 |
781 | 10 | 2020-03-08 a 2020-03-15 | 36 |
He estado trabajando en este informe por un tiempo y he llegado a un bloqueo de carretera con esta parte también necesito que esta columna se incluya en algunos de mis otros cálculos para Horas Extras, PTO, ect. Cualquier ayuda está aprefiada. ¡Gracias!
Tratar:
@cmilligan262 ¡Gracias! Esto funcionó exactamente como se esperaba. Después de agregar esto me di cuenta de que necesito tener solo un valor por período de parte de horas. ¿Sería posible que parezca la tableta de abajo? También hay una columna de fecha en esta tabla (Last_Updated) que está disponible si se puede hacer en función de qué entrada es la primera, si tiene sentido?
MemberID | Hours_Logged | Timesheet_Period | WeekTotal |
781 | 30 | 2020-03-01 a 2020-03-07 | 40 |
781 | 26 | 2020-03-08 a 2020-03-15 | 36 |
781 | 10 | 2020-03-01 a 2020-03-07 | 0 |
781 | 10 | 2020-03-08 a 2020-03-15 | 0 |
No estoy seguro de si puedo conseguir que muestre 0's como usted quiere, pero intente crear una tabla resumida para que solo muestre el total de la semana.
Crear una nueva tabla con la fórmula
Tabla resumida: RESUME('Table','Table'[MemberID],'Table'[Timesheet_Period],"Week Total",Sum('Table'[Hours_Logged]))
Dependiendo de la salida que desee y lo que está intentando crear esto puede hacerse mejor como una medida.